html, body {
font-family : verdana, arial, sans-serif;
font-size : 1em;
color : white;
background-image : url(images/recycling1.jpg);
background-color : #c3c3c3;
margin-top : 0;
margin-bottom : 0;
overflow:auto;
}

h1 {
font-family : verdana, arial, sans-serif;
color : #000000;
font-size : 2.5em;
text-align : center;
font-weight : bold;
letter-spacing : 2px;
}
h2 {
font-family : verdana, arial, sans-serif;
color : #4f6f7f;
font-size : 1.5em;
text-align : center;
font-weight : bold;
font-style : italic;
letter-spacing : 2px;
}

h2.kontakt {
font-family : verdana, arial, sans-serif;
color : #4f6f7f;
font-size : 1.2em;
text-align : left;
font-weight : bold;
font-style : italic;
letter-spacing : 2px;
line-height : 50%;
}

h3 {
font-family : verdana, arial, sans-serif;
color : #c3c3c3;
font-size : 1.4em;
text-align : center;
font-weight : bold;
letter-spacing : 1.9px;
}

h3 {
font-family : verdana, arial, sans-serif;
color : #EFEFEF;
font-size : 1.5em;
text-align : center;
font-weight : bold;
font-variant:small-caps;
word-spacing: 1em;
letter-spacing : 2px;
}

h3.schultz {
font-family : verdana, arial, sans-serif;
color : #EFEFEF;
font-size : 2em;
text-align : center;
font-weight : bold;
font-variant:small-caps;
word-spacing: 1em;
letter-spacing : 2px;
}

h3.schultz2 {
font-family : verdana, arial, sans-serif;
color : #EFEFEF;
font-size : 1.5em;
text-align : center;
font-weight : bold;
letter-spacing : 1px;
}

h3.schultz3 {
font-family : verdana, arial, sans-serif;
color : #EFEFEF;
font-size : 1.5em;
text-align : center;
font-weight : bold;
letter-spacing : 1px;
}

h4 {
font-family : verdana, arial, sans-serif;
color : #ffffff;
font-size : 1.05em;
text-align : center;
font-weight : bold;
letter-spacing : 2px;
}
.sonderabfall {
font-family : verdana, arial, sans-serif;
color : #EFEFEF;
font-size : 1.1em;
text-align : left;
letter-spacing : 1px;
}

h5.name2 {
font-family : verdana, arial, sans-serif;
color : #ffffff;
font-size : 1.1em;
text-align : left;
font-weight : bold;
letter-spacing : 2px;
line-height : 50%;
}

h5.name {
font-family : verdana, arial, sans-serif;
color : #000000;
font-size : 1em;
text-align : left;
font-weight : bold;
font-style : italic;
letter-spacing : 2px;
line-height : 50%;
}

table {
text-align: center;
margin-left : 0;
margin-right : 0;
margin-top : 0;
color : white;
font-family : verdana, arial, sans-serif;
font-size : 11px;
scrollbar-base-color: #4f6f7f;
scrollbar-arrow-color: #c3c3c3;
scrollbar-3dlight-color: #c3c3c3;
scrollbar-track-color: #c3c3c3;
}

td {
 text-align: justify;
}

.bilder {
 text-align: left;
}

.bilder2 {
 text-align: center;
}

.bilder3 {
 text-align: right;
}

.ontop {
background-image : url(images/butt3.gif);
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 3px;
padding-top : 3px;
margin : 0 auto;
}
#navi a {
display : block;
background-image : url(images/back.gif);
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0;
border : 1px solid #89a9b8;
}
#navi a:visited {
background-image : url(images/back.gif);
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0 auto;
border : 1px solid #89a9b8;
}
#navi a:active {
background-image : url(images/back.gif);
color : white;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0 auto;
border : 1px solid #89a9b8;
}
#navi a:hover {
background-color : #89a9b8;
background-image : url(images/back1.gif);
color : white;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0 auto;
border : 1px solid #e6e6e6;
}
.navi a {
display : block;
background-image : url(images/back.gif);
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 3px;
padding-top : 3px;
margin : 0 auto;
border : 1px solid #89a9b8;
}
.navi a:visited {
background-image : url(images/back.gif);
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 3px;
padding-top : 3px;
margin : 0 auto;
border : 1px solid #89a9b8;
}
.navi a:active {
background-image : url(images/back.gif);
color : white;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 3px;
padding-top : 3px;
margin : 0 auto;
border : 1px solid #89a9b8;
}
.navi a:hover {
background-color : #89a9b8;
background-image : url(images/back1.gif);
color : white;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 3px;
padding-top : 3px;
margin : 0 auto;
border : 1px solid #e6e6e6;
}
#navi2 a {
display : block;
background-image : url(images/back.gif);
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0 auto;
border : 1px solid #89a9b8;
}
#navi2 a:visited {
background-image : url(images/back.gif);
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0 auto;
border : 1px solid #89a9b8;
}
#navi2 a:active {
background-image : url(images/back.gif);
color : white;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0 auto;
border : 1px solid #89a9b8;
}
#navi2 a:hover {
background-color : #89a9b8;
background-image : url(images/back1.gif);
color : white;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0 auto;
border : 1px solid #e6e6e6;
}

#navi3 a {
display : block;
background-image : url(images/back.gif);
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0 auto;
border : 1px solid #89a9b8;
}
#navi3 a:visited {
background-image : url(images/back.gif);
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0 auto;
border : 1px solid #89a9b8;
}
#navi3 a:active {
background-image : url(images/back.gif);
color : white;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0 auto;
border : 1px solid #89a9b8;
}
#navi3 a:hover {
background-color : #89a9b8;
background-image : url(images/back1.gif);
color : white;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 1em;
width : 160px;
padding-left : 3px;
padding-bottom : 2px;
padding-top : 2px;
margin : 0 auto;
border : 1px solid #e6e6e6;
}

.cont {
font-family : verdana, arial, sans-serif;
font-size : 1em;
color : #4f6f7f;
font-weight : bold;
}
a:link {
color : white;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 12px;
}
a:visited {
color : white;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 12px;
}
a:active {
color : white;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 12px;
}
a:hover {
color : silver;
text-decoration : none;
font-family : verdana, arial, sans-serif;
font-size : 12px;
}
#alo a:link {
color : #808080;
text-decoration : none;
text-align : right;
font-family : verdana, sans-serif;
font-size : 1em;
}
#alo a:visited {
color : #808080;
text-decoration : none;
text-align : right;
font-family : verdana, sans-serif;
font-size : 1em;
}
#alo a:active {
color : #4f6f7f;
text-decoration : none;
text-align : right;
font-family : verdana, sans-serif;
font-size : 1em;
}
#alo a:hover {
color : #4f6f7f;
text-decoration : none;
text-align : right;
font-family : verdana, sans-serif;
font-size : 1em;
}

.box {
width : 160px;
color : #000000;
background : #c3c3c3;
text-decoration : none;
font-family : Verdana, Arial, sans-serif;
font-size : 10px;
text-align : left;
border : #ccccdd;
border-style : solid;
border-top-width : 1px;
border-right-width : 1px;
border-bottom-width : 1px;
border-left-width : 1px;
padding-top : 4px;
padding-bottom : 4px;
padding-left : 2px;
padding-right : 2px;
}
.box2 {
width : 250px;
color : #000000;
background : #c3c3c3;
text-decoration : none;
font-family : Verdana, Arial, sans-serif;
font-size : 10px;
text-align : left;
border : #ccccdd;
border-style : double;
border-top-width : 3px;
border-right-width : 3px;
border-bottom-width : 3px;
border-left-width : 3px;
padding-top : 5px;
padding-bottom : 5px;
padding-left : 5px;
padding-right : 5px;
}
.box3 {
width : 100px;
color : #000000;
background : #c3c3c3;
text-decoration : none;
font-family : Verdana, Arial, sans-serif;
font-size : 10px;
text-align : center;
border : #ccccdd;
border-style : double;
border-top-width : 3px;
border-right-width : 3px;
border-bottom-width : 3px;
border-left-width : 3px;
padding-top : 5px;
padding-bottom : 5px;
padding-left : 5px;
padding-right : 5px;
}

.zitat {
 font-style: italic;
}

#zitat a:link {
color : #ffffff;
}
#zitat a:hover {
text-decoration : underline;
}
.sonder {
font-family : verdana, arial, sans-serif;
color : #c3c3c3;
font-size : 1.2em;
font-weight : bold;
font-style : italic;
letter-spacing : 2px;
}
.border {
border-width : 5px;
border-style : ridge;
border-color : #4f6f7f;
}
.border1 {
border-width : 2px;
border-style : ridge;
border-color : #c3c3c3;
}
.border2 {
border-width : 5px;
border-style : double;
border-color : #c3c3c3;
}
